Wilma Claudine Reeves Maxey Kneisly

Wilma Claudine Reeves Maxey Kneisly, at age 85, departed this life to realized the promises of her faith from NMMC Hospice in Tupelo.  Wilma transformed to eternal life on Friday, October 7, 2022.  Born in Saltillo on November 23, 1936 to the late Claude Reeves and Nora Jane Reeves, she grew up here and married Gillie Bernard Maxey, who died in 1979.  She later married Ralph Kneisly, who died in 2009.  Wilma graduated from Itawamba Agricultural High School, attended Cosmetology school.  She later worked many years as the Transportation Secretary for Gulf State’s Manufacturer’s in Starkville, where they lived over 22 years.   A true southern Magnolia, Wilma had a pleasant personality, a genuine interest in others and a steely devotion to her faith.  She was a longtime member of Harrisburg Baptist Church but recently due to failing health, attended Faith Baptist Church in Saltillo.
